[0001] This utility model relates to the field of photovoltaic installation equipment technology, and in particular to an installation clamp for photovoltaic equipment. Background Technology
[0002] Photovoltaic power generation is a technology that uses the photovoltaic effect at the semiconductor interface to directly convert light energy into electrical energy. Photovoltaic power generation modules mainly consist of three parts: solar panels, controllers, and inverters. Solar panels are mainly made of silicon crystal sheets, which are heavy and brittle. Therefore, installation clamps are needed to install and fix the photovoltaic power generation modules. Some photovoltaic equipment also needs to be installed and fixed on corrugated steel sheets.
[0003] Existing photovoltaic equipment installation clamps typically include a connection part to the color steel tile, a support part to support the photovoltaic equipment, and a clamping part to hold the photovoltaic equipment in place. For example, Chinese Patent Publication No. CN216451308U discloses "an installation clamp for photovoltaic equipment, which can effectively achieve connection and fixation with the inclined part of the color steel tile body by setting a support component. It can effectively improve the connection strength between the photovoltaic flexible module and the installation clamp, avoid the problem of traditionally needing to be glued to the surface of the color steel tile body, and greatly improve its installation efficiency."
[0004] However, in actual use, fixing photovoltaic modules is complicated, and when installing in large quantities, the installation efficiency is low and the installation period is increased. Utility Model Content

[0022] Reference Figure 1-4 An installation clamp for photovoltaic equipment includes a base 1 connected to a color steel tile. The base 1 is existing technology and will not be described in detail here. It can be fixed to the color steel tile by means of adhesive, magnetic attraction, screws, etc. A connecting frame 2 is provided on the base 1. A connecting plate 21 is fixedly provided at the lower end of the connecting frame 2. A clamping frame 3 is rotatably provided on the connecting frame 2. A connecting piece 4 is provided on the clamping frame 3. A pressure block 5 that cooperates with the photovoltaic module is provided on the connecting piece 4. A limit mechanism 6 is provided between the connecting frame 2 and the clamping frame 3. A height adjustment component 7 is provided on the base 1. The connecting frame 2 is provided on the height adjustment component 7.
[0023] In this utility model, except for the pressure block 5, all parts are made of stainless steel or coated with anti-rust paint. By controlling the limiting mechanism 6, it drives the clamping frame 3 to move. The photovoltaic module is clamped and fixed by the pressure block 5 on the clamping frame 3. The operation is simple and the efficiency is higher when installing in large batches, thereby shortening the installation period. By setting the height adjustment component 7, the height of the connecting frame 2 and the clamping frame 3 can be adjusted, thereby changing the distance between the pressure block 5 and the base 1, which can clamp and fix photovoltaic panels of different thicknesses.
[0024] Furthermore, in this embodiment, the limiting mechanism 6 includes a drive frame 61 that is rotatably connected to the connecting frame 2. The drive frame 61 is provided with a handle for easy driving. A connecting rod 62 is provided between the drive frame 61 and the clamping frame 3. When fixing the photovoltaic module, the drive frame 61 is pushed to rotate, which drives the connecting rod 62 to move. The connecting rod 62 pushes the clamping frame 3 and the pressure block 5 to move, and the pressure block 5 moves down to fix the photovoltaic module.
[0025] Furthermore, in this embodiment, the two ends of the connecting rod 62 are rotatably connected to the drive frame 61 and the clamping frame 3, respectively. A limiting plate 63 that cooperates with the clamping frame 3 is fixedly provided on the connecting rod 62. When the drive frame 61 rotates and drives the connecting rod 62 to move, the angle between the connecting rod 62 and the support of the drive frame 61 gradually decreases, while the angle between the connecting rod 62 and the clamping frame 3 gradually increases. The clamping frame 3 also rotates and drives the pressure block 5 to move down and change position until the connecting rod 62 coincides with the drive frame 61 and the connecting rod 62 is perpendicular to the clamping frame 3. At this time, the pressure block 5 on the clamping frame 3 abuts against the photovoltaic module to fix the photovoltaic module. The limiting plate 63 contacts the clamping frame 3 and limits the clamping frame 3 to prevent it from rotating and causing the pressure block 5 to separate from the photovoltaic module.
[0026] It should be noted that, in this embodiment, the height adjustment component 7 includes a groove formed on the base 1, a lifting plate 71 is slidably disposed in the groove, and a first bolt 72 is axially fixedly connected to the lifting plate 71, that is, the first bolt 72 can rotate freely, but cannot move up and down. The first bolt 72 is threadedly connected to the groove. When it is necessary to adjust the height of the lifting plate 71 and the connecting frame 2, the first bolt 72 is rotated to change its position, thereby driving the lifting plate 71 and the connecting frame 2 to change their positions.
[0027] Furthermore, in this embodiment, a sliding groove is provided on the lifting plate 71, and a slider 73 is slidably disposed in the sliding groove. The connecting plate 21 is fixedly connected to the slider 73 by connecting parts such as screws and rivets. A second bolt 74 is threadedly connected to the slider 73. The lower end of the second bolt 74 passes through the slider 73 and contacts the sliding groove. By setting the slider 73 to cooperate with the sliding groove, the position of the connecting frame 2 and the pressure block 5 can be changed, thereby adapting to photovoltaic modules of different specifications. The slider 73 and the sliding groove are preferably dovetail blocks and dovetail grooves, but similar structures such as T-blocks and T-grooves can also be used for replacement. After the position of the slider 73 is adjusted, the lower end of the second bolt 74 is rotated to abut against the sliding groove, thereby fixing the slider 73.
[0028] More specifically, in this embodiment, the clamping frame 3 is provided with a movable groove, the connecting member 4 is a bolt that is slidably disposed in the movable groove, the bolt is threaded with a nut that abuts against the clamping frame 3, the connecting member 4 is threadedly connected to the pressure block 5, and the connecting member 4 can move in the movable groove to adjust the position of the pressure block 5, the pressure block 5 is preferably a rubber block.
